Core Insights - NVIDIA and Lenovo are collaborating to develop an enterprise-level AI system based on RTX Pro, aiming to enhance AI capabilities in various industries [4] - The partnership has seen a fivefold increase in business scale over the past two years, indicating strong growth potential [3] - Both companies foresee a shift from generative AI to agent-based AI, which will integrate public cloud models with customized private models [3][5] Group 1 - The collaboration between NVIDIA and Lenovo has reached a significant milestone after 28 years, with expectations to expand fivefold in the next two years [3][5] - The focus is on hybrid AI, which combines public and private models, requiring robust infrastructure that the joint enterprise-level AI system will provide [3] - The anticipated trends include the integration of hybrid enterprise intelligence across various sectors, such as high-performance computing and industrial intelligence [3] Group 2 - NVIDIA's CEO expressed excitement about launching a revolutionary server aimed at the enterprise market, with technical details to be revealed at an upcoming global innovation conference [4] - The upgrade of system architecture to rack-level computing has improved token efficiency by 10 to 15 times, showcasing significant technological advancement [5] - The collaboration is expected to unlock substantial application potential in industries like logistics, warehousing, and robotics [5]
